  3. A fair way to estimate it coast to coast estimate it is to take 11 pounds 15 ounces (world record smallmouth ) and divide by 22 pounds and 4 ounces ( world record largemouth). That should put you in the 5.5 pound range. Or you could break it down to northern strain and say 15 pound to 12 pound ratio. This would increase the weight of the smallmouth in comparison, putting you very close to roadwarriors 8 pound estimate. WRB could give exacts I’m sure because I don’t know the record northern strain. I know TN kicked out a 14.5 pound northern strain back in the 50s.

  14. Many, many many reel experts leave those out. It is a backup and if it fails it will cause noise at best and cause internal damage at worst. It backs up the (anti reverse bearing ARB). If said bearing fails, you can buy another aARB.
